It is the mission of the office to ensure the democratic rights of all Manitobans through the conduct of free and fair provincial elections, by ensuring compliance with political financing laws and by enhancing public confidence in and awareness of the electoral process.Elections Manitoba is seeking an individual with strong project management and policy development skills to work directly with the chief electoral officer to coordinate a variety of projects, systems and presentations across the organization. The Manager of Corporate Services assists in driving efforts to meet the needs, standards and strategic objectives of Elections Manitoba working in an inter-disciplinary manner internally and with external partners.Conditions of Employment:
